Join educators from the National Air and Space Museum as we explore our dynamic solar system. In this live, interactive show, participants will explore how planets in our solar system change over time, and how some have seasons - and others don’t! Staff will be there to answer your questions about our cosmic neighborhood and beyond. This program is designed for families with kids ages 8-12, but all are welcome to participate!
